Blitzboks bounce back to beat Scotland

Cape Town - The Blitzboks put the disappointment of crashing out of the Cup competition at the World Rugby Sevens series stop in Dubai in the quarter-final stage behind them with a thumping victory over Scotland in the Plate playoffs on Saturday.

The Blitzboks beat their Scottish opponents 29-0 after leading 5-0 at half-time.

The Blitzboks scored tries through Muller du Plessis (2), Zain Davids, Rosko Specman and Werner Kok. Dewald Human added two conversions.

Neil Powell's side will face the winner of the Fiji v Argentina clash in the battle for 5th/6th at the tournament.

That match is scheduled for 16:40 SA time.

Earlier, the Blitzboks were thrashed 22-5 by England in their Cup quarter-final clash.

On Friday, the Blitzboks, who are the reigning Sevens series world champions, beat Zimbabwe 31-0 and Samoa 19-12, but lost 19-12 to Argentina.

The Blitzboks were the defending Dubai champions.
